About:China Work Visa

Hi! I just want to ask if a medical exam is needed to get a working visa?

A medical exam is required for Filipinos to get a work visa, but as I know, it is not required for work visa application in Australia and USA even though the embassy website states it is a requirement. Work visa holders have to apply for Residence Permit within 30 days after entering China, they need to do the medical examination again at the Entry-Exit Inspection and Quarantine Bureau for residence permit application.
